Lolo Santosa is the founder of Toko-Toko, an online and pop-up shop. Their shop offers  Indonesian brands that are created and based on Sustainable and Fair Trade principles.  Products range from fashion, home goods and accessories.  They currently work with artisans in Jogjakarta and Flores to create their in-house brand Martini and Milk. Lolo spoke to her father when she went back home to Indonesia. Her family is from an island called Java, and although she had been living in the US a long time she felt like she needed to go back to her roots for clarity. It was clear that the law degree Lolo had achieved in school wasn't feeding her soul. It wasn't giving her the purpose that she desperately was trying to understand. All she knew was that there were little things in her life that were calling her. The environment, sustainable fashion, and the Javanese people that she cared about so deeply.
